Other State Benefits

If you are struggling to pay for things like food, health care, medications, or utilities, there are several state programs that might be able to help you. Your local Area Agency on Aging can help you figure out what programs you qualify for, and can help you apply to these programs. Call your local Area Agency on Aging at 1-877-353-3771.

Or, you can visit the National Council on Aging’s “Benefits Checkup” website to find benefit programs that can help you pay for medications, health care, food, utilities and more. Visit the Benefits Checkup website by clicking here.
